초록

This paper proposes a joint optimization of power allocation and subcarrier pairing for a cyclic prefixed singlecarrier cognitive two-way relay network. The optimal frequencydomain linear equalization receiver and the decision-feedback equalization receiver are considered. Karush-Kunh-Tucker conditions and a dynamic ordering greedy algorithm are applied to efficiently solve the joint optimization problem.
